import java.util.*; import java.net.*; import java.io.*; public class Post2CometServlet { public static void main(String[] args) throws Exception { try { // Construct data String data = URLEncoder.encode("client", "UTF-8") + "=" + URLEncoder.encode("sreeni", "UTF-8"); java.util.Date dt = new java.util.Date(); data += "&" + URLEncoder.encode("message", "UTF-8") + "=" + URLEncoder.encode("my message sent at " + dt.getTime() + "\n", "UTF-8"); // Send data URL url = new URL("http://localhost:8080/comet/mycomet"); URLConnection conn = url.openConnection(); conn.setDoOutput(true); OutputStreamWriter wr = new OutputStreamWriter(conn.getOutputStream()); wr.write(data); wr.flush(); wr.close(); // Get the response BufferedReader rd = new BufferedReader(new InputStreamReader(conn.getInputStream())); String line; while ((line = rd.readLine()) != null) { } rd.close(); } catch (Exception e) { System.out.println("Exception: " + e.getMessage()); e.printStackTrace(); } } }